Ordinals
beta
Sat 1354346362091811
decimal
45815.2562091811
percentile
2.708692724183622%
name
mfomawxhybde
cycle
0
epoch
2
block
45815
offset
2562091811
timestamp
2024-01-20 23:28:15 UTC
rarity
common
prev
next